Maintenance

Engine Oil

NOTE: After the engine break-in
period, the engine oil should be
changed every 100 operating hours
(6 months) and before prolonged
storage.
Checking
The engine oil level should be checked
each day before operating the snowmo-
bile.
The snowmobile must be on a level sur-
face for this procedure.

1. Release the two hold-down straps
and open the hood.
2. Remove the oil level stick and wipe
it with a clean cloth.
3. Install the oil level stick and remove
the oil level stick; the engine oil
level should be within the operating
range but not above the MAX/FULL
mark.

4. If step 1-3 was followed and the oil
level is not within the operating
range, add the recommended engine
oil through the oil stick tube. Install
the oil level stick and close and latch
the hood.
Changing
1. Remove the access plug; then place
a drain pan beneath the engine.
2. Release the two hold-down straps
and open the hood.
3. Remove the oil drain plug from the
crankcase and allow the oil to drain.
4. Install the drain plug and the access
plug.
5. Remove the oil level stick; then pour
600 mL (20.3 fl oz) of recom-
mended oil into the oil level stick
tube.
6. Check the oil level using the oil
level stick making sure the oil is
within the operating range.
7. Close the hood and secure with the
two straps.
